Vendor Manager – Driving Value Through Strategic PartnershipsAbout The RoleWe are seeking an accomplished Vendor Manager to join our team and own our vendor landscape. This is a key role where you will shape how we collaborate with our suppliers, optimize spend, and ensure our investments directly support business performance and growth.The ideal candidate combines extensive commercial acumen with a strategic mindset and the ability to build trust-based relationships across all levels. You will manage end-to-end vendor performance, negotiate impactful agreements, and help us attain the right balance between quality, value, and operational efficiency.Key ResponsibilitiesVendor ManagementEstablish and maintain strong, long-term partnerships with key vendors.Monitor and evaluate vendor performance, ensuring service excellence and continuous improvement.Cost OptimizationManage contract negotiations and evaluations to ensure financial efficiency and increased value.Track and analyze cost developments, diligently identifying opportunities for savings and improvement.CAPEX and OPEX ManagementCollaborate closely with Finance and Operations to plan, manage, and report on capital and operational expenditures.Align vendor spend with business priorities, budgets, and financial goals.Strategic PlanningDevelop and implement vendor management strategies that drive growth, professionalism, and innovation.Conduct market research to assess supplier options, emerging trends, and new partnership opportunities.Risk Management and ComplianceIdentify, assess, and mitigate risks across all vendor relationships.Ensure adherence to internal policies, ethical standards, and regulatory requirements.QualificationsBach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Supply Chain Management, or a related field.Extensive experience in vendor management, procurement, or supplier relations.Solid understanding of CAPEX and OPEX principles.Proficient negotiation, communication, and stakeholder management skills.Structured approach with the ability to interpret data and translate insights into action.Proficiency in Microsoft Office and familiarity with procurement systems or ERP tools.Why Join UsWe believe that effective partnerships are fundamental to sustained growth.
